About Olfa Hamzaoui

Olfa Hamzaoui is a scholar working on Critical Care and Intensive Care Medicine, Nephrology, Emergency Medicine, Surgery and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, having authored 52 papers that have together received 1.4k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Hemodynamic Monitoring and Therapy (31 papers), Sepsis Diagnosis and Treatment (18 papers), Cardiac Arrest and Resuscitation (7 papers), Renal function and acid-base balance (7 papers), Intensive Care Unit Cognitive Disorders (7 papers), Ultrasound in Clinical Applications (6 papers), Heart Rate Variability and Autonomic Control (6 papers) and Non-Invasive Vital Sign Monitoring (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Critical Care and Intensive Care Medicine (394 citations), Emergency Medicine (223 citations), Epidemiology (710 citations), Nephrology (143 citations) and Surgery (773 citations). Olfa Hamzaoui has collaborated with scholars based in France, United States and Belgium. Frequent co-authors include Jean–Louis Teboul, Xavier Monnet, Christian Richard, David Osman, Julien Maizel, Jean-François Georger, Nadia Anguel, D. S. Chemla, Rui Shi and Anis Chaari. Their work appears in journals such as Annals of Intensive Care, Intensive Care Medicine, Critical Care, Critical Care Medicine and Intensive Care Medicine Experimental.
